Heracles
Description
The story behind this fragrance
Heracles opens with a sharp pink pepper bite tempered by geranium's green herbaceousness and the smooth wooden warmth of Brazilian rosewood. The heart softens into a lush floral tapestry—boronia's honeyed roundness anchors lavender's cool clarity, while African orange flower and jasmine add creamy opacity against a rosy base. As it settles, styrax and amber create a resinous foundation, with ambrette lending a whispered musk-like softness. Sandalwood, cassis, and benzoin deepen the dry-sweet conclusion, leaving a lingering amber-tinged warmth.
